Megan grew up training in California for 10 years and quickly excelled to a high level of
Classical ballet, Pointe, and Contemporary. Megan has trained with Bobby Amamizu,
Evet, Roberto Almaguer, Rochelle Berwick, Gina Cerato, Kenneth Walker and many
more professional artists. In 2016, Megan began dancing for Riverside’s professional
company, CODA (Company Of Dance Artists) following her dreams of a professional
career in Ballet. As of 2022, Megan dances professionally for Inland Dance Theatre.
She has performed for many years including Soloist and Principal roles in Classical and
Neoclassical Ballets. Performing roles such as Sugar Plum fairy, Dew Drop Fairy, Snow
Queen in The Nutcracker. Kitri in Don Quixote. The Black Swan, Odile, In Swan Lake.
The Mad Hatter in Alice Through The Looking Glass. More recently Megan performed
as Spanish Soloist, The Nutctacker, and Waltz of the Flowers Soloist in The Nutcracker

Ballet.

Never missing an opportunity to be on stage. She also became well known in the
competition community and competed for 9 years winning various awards and being
recognized for her beautiful classical ballet technique. YAGP (2017 Top 12 Classical
Category), YAGP (2019 Top 12 Classical Category), YAGP (2021 Top 12 Classical & Contemporary
Category) KAR (Dancer Of The Year) to name a few. Megan has also won various titles &
Dancer of the year awards. She has also taught and choreographed for 7 years;
Choreographing pieces for YAGP, commercial competitions, and shows. Megan was
recognized in 2017 with a choreography award at just age 14. Megan plans to continue
teaching, judging, and performing as a guest artist to explore new paths in the dance
world. Megan believes a well rounded dancer must learn to love the technical side of all
styles of dance and looks forward to teaching many young artists to love and embrace

their art.
